Savory Ground Beef and Fried Cabbage Skillet Recipe Unveiled!

A delicious and hearty skillet dish featuring savory ground beef and tender fried cabbage, perfect for a quick weeknight meal.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 35 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Main Dish
Cuisine: American
Calories: 320

Ingredients
  

  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 medium head of green cabbage chopped (about 6 cups)
  • 1 medium onion diced
  • 3 cloves garlic minced
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on black pepper
  • ½ teaspoon red pepper flakes optional
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
  • 1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
  • Fresh parsley chopped (for garnish)

Method
 

  1. In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the diced onion and sauté for about 3-4 minutes until translucent.
  2. Add the minced garlic and cook for an additional 1 minute until fragrant.
  3. Increase the heat to medium-high and add the ground beef to the skillet. Cook until browned, breaking it apart with a spatula, about 5-7 minutes. Drain excess fat if necessary.
  4. Stir in the chopped cabbage, paprika, salt, black pepper, and red pepper flakes. Cook for about 10-12 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the cabbage is tender and slightly caramelized.
  5. Add the soy sauce, apple cider vinegar, and Worcestershire sauce to the skillet. Mix well and cook for another 2-3 minutes.
  6. Remove from heat and garnish with fresh parsley before serving.

Notes

  • For a low-carb option, you can add more vegetables like bell peppers or zucchini instead of rice or pasta.
  • Spice it up by adding a teaspoon of cumin or chili powder for an extra kick.
